Choosing the Right Robot Vacuum with a Large Dustbin

When considering a robot vacuum with a large dustbin, several features significantly impact performance and convenience. Here’s a breakdown of key aspects to consider:

Dustbin Capacity & Self-Emptying Base

The primary reason for wanting a large dustbin is reduced maintenance. Look for models with dustbin capacities of 3 liters or more, especially if you have pets or a large home. Crucially, consider whether it’s paired with a self-emptying base. These bases automatically suck the dirt and debris from the robot into a larger bag (often holding weeks or even months of waste), meaning you won’t need to empty the robot daily or even weekly. A larger bag capacity in the base is also beneficial, extending the time between bag replacements. This feature is a significant time-saver and a key benefit for those who want a truly “set it and forget it” cleaning experience.

Suction Power & Cleaning Performance

Dustbin size is important, but it’s useless without sufficient suction power to collect the dirt in the first place. Suction is measured in Pascals (Pa). Generally, 4,000Pa is good for everyday cleaning, but 6,000Pa or higher is preferable for homes with pets, carpets, or significant debris. Beyond the raw power number, look for features like adjustable suction levels. This allows the vacuum to optimize performance on different floor types – maximizing power on carpets and reducing it on hard floors to conserve battery life. Many models also include specialized brushrolls designed to minimize hair tangling, which is crucial for pet owners.

Navigation & Mapping Technology

A robot vacuum with a large dustbin is an investment; you want it to clean efficiently. This is where navigation technology comes into play. LiDAR (Light Detection and Ranging) is considered the gold standard, using lasers to create a detailed map of your home. This allows the robot to clean in a systematic, efficient pattern, avoiding obstacles and ensuring complete coverage. Some models offer multi-floor mapping, allowing you to store maps for different levels of your home. Simpler models may use less accurate (but cheaper) random bounce navigation, which can result in missed spots and longer cleaning times. The ability to set no-go zones and virtual walls through the accompanying app is also a valuable feature to prevent the robot from entering areas you want to avoid.

Additional Features to Consider

  • Mopping Functionality: Some models combine vacuuming and mopping. Consider if this is a feature you need.
  • Battery Life: Longer runtimes mean the robot can clean larger areas on a single charge. Look for models with at least 90 minutes of runtime, and ideally, those that automatically return to the base to recharge and resume cleaning.
  • App Control & Voice Assistant Compatibility: Most modern robot vacuums are controlled through a smartphone app, allowing you to schedule cleanings, adjust settings, and monitor progress. Compatibility with voice assistants like Alexa or Google Assistant adds another layer of convenience.
  • Obstacle Avoidance: Advanced models use sensors to detect and avoid common obstacles like furniture, cords, and even pet waste.
